Linux defines a few custom flags for waitpid(), make them available to nolibc based programs.
Signed-off-by: Mark Brown <broonie@kernel.org> --- tools/include/nolibc/types.h | 5 ++++- 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/tools/include/nolibc/types.h b/tools/include/nolibc/types.h index 8cfc4c860fa4..801ea0bb186e 100644 --- a/tools/include/nolibc/types.h +++ b/tools/include/nolibc/types.h @@ -109,7 +109,10 @@ #define WIFSIGNALED(status) ((status) - 1 < 0xff) /* waitpid() flags */ -#define WNOHANG 1 +#define WNOHANG 0x00000001 +#define __WNOTHREAD 0x20000000 +#define __WALL 0x40000000 +#define __WCLONE 0x80000000 /* standard exit() codes */ #define EXIT_SUCCESS 0 --- base-commit: 6465e260f48790807eef06b583b38ca9789b6072 change-id: 20231020-nolibc-waitpid-flags-80ac075ab978 Best regards, -- Mark Brown <broonie@kernel.org>
